Compostable film for vegan chocolates

Sustainable vegan chocolate producer, the nu company, has chosen Futamura’s renewable and compostable NatureFlex™ packaging films for two of its latest vegan chocolate ranges of the brand “nucao."

German food startup the nu company, being eager to find a working alternative to conventional plastic packaging, opted for NatureFlex compostable cellulose films. These films are manufactured from responsibly sourced wood pulp and are certified acfcording to EN13432 for Industrial Composting and TUV Austria OK Compost Home for home composting. According to Futamura, NatureFlex offers outstanding technical performance including high barrier to gases, moisture, and oils, while offering renewability and an end-of-life option that diverts waste from landfill, since it can go straight into the garden compost bin.
